Excellent Aged Sushi
Aged Sushi YU-EN
2021-11-05
Yu-en is the first restaurant in Hong Kong to offer real aged sushi. Real, because we can see the fish in the dry aging fridge and they all taste so heavenly. The restaurant is big with high ceilings but only seats like 10 people. The staff described every detail of the restaurand and the aged sushi patiently.Shari is slightly warm to match the soft texture of aged fish.45 days aged maguro - never imagined to have the chance to try that in my life! Very delicious and complex, say caramel, bacon, smoked cheese. Unforgettable taste.Another reason to visit in November because our favorite Sanma is seasonal. Aged for 8 days but still nothing fishy and tastes powerful. OMG. The sauce is so strong and tasty.Sujiko, Bora shirako, Buri, horsehair crab... and a lot of other nicely made dishes.Great food. Comfy space. Excellent service. Seems it's getting harder and harder to book now. That's why we already made a booking for the next visit when we dined in.…Read More

Best of the Best
BUKAN Japanese Restaurant
2018-11-14
If you're planning to eat at Bukan, do not expect a luxurious Michelin experience. Instead, it's a cosy restaurant where you can enjoy rare and delicious seafood from Japan and communicate with the chef (who's also the owner) about food, traveling and life! Our first visit at Bukan was about half a year ago at a shop twice the size of this one. Back then the atmosphere was more high-end but on the down-side, you have to be a repeat guest to be able to sit right in front of Chef Takeshi. If we got to choose, we'd pick the smaller restaurant now. It's a place where you can eat really fresh sashimi and make new friends.We highly recommend you to visit in November for Sanma. We tried Sanma at other restaurants but it was way too fishy. The Sanma at Bukan is not fishy at all and Chef Takeshi has added his own recipe of Sanma liver sauce which is unbeatable!Other seasonal seafood of fall that surprised us are Ankimo, Bora-shirako, live sea urchin and mega Hokkigai. We can't take raw oysters so Chef Takeshi has specially grilled them for us. Very heartwarming!…Read More

First Omakase Experience in HK
BUKAN Japanese Restaurant
2018-05-11
We've always loved Japanese food, especially sashimi. We came across Bukan on Openrice and thought we could give it a try - because reviews say it's one of the most value for money Omakase restaurants in town. The whole course took 3 hours with around 25 or 30 dishes. We could still ate an udon at the end of the meal though. Chef introduced each dish to us as he served. A lot of fish were new to us. Everything was incredibly fresh and delicate. The whole Omakase experience was like a journey from Okinawa to Hokkaido as the ingredients were from all parts of Japan. Tastes like uni and shrimp, because these are what octopus feed on. Interesting.This is not what you think it is. It's called ときしらず which can be translated as the trout that has no time concept lol. Really rare species that can only be found in every 10000 trouts.You can tell its from Hokkaido by the pattern on its head. Fresh, crispy and sweetRich and oily toro. Wife's favorite.It's still alive! So different from the uni we eat at other high-end restaurants. Sweet and rich.…Read More
